Wonder Girls’ Hyuna shows that a Korean gradient lip look can also be bold and striking – just use a hot pink shade in the centre of the lips and work out the gradient towards your lips’ outline.

There’s a reason why the lipstick shades that Korean actress Park Shin Hye sports always sell like hotcakes – her lips just look so good in any colour. To make a bright pink shade like the one pictured appropriate for work, keep the rest of your makeup minimal and don’t go overboard with the blusher.

Even if you want to look professional, you don’t have to keep your lipstick neutral, as proven by Rainie Yang here. The coral-slash-reddish orange lipstick colour here hits the right balance between between being too bold or too subtle and adds to a modern, confident woman look.
